The clean, uncrowded beaches of Pie de La Cuesta are devoid of swimmers for large segments of the year, and with good simple reason. Every year, a few people drown here when the ferocious rip tides, undertow or unusual wave formations catch them unawares. The forum is normally an archaeological complex a person simply can enter from the piazza leading from the Colosseum. The Colosseum, of course, will be the symbol of Rome. This is the famous amphitheatre that was able to hold up to 55,000 spectators as they watched gladiator fights, animal fights, etcetera. Completed in 80AD, it took 10 years to construct and originally had a variable canvas - the precursor to today's stadiums with adjustable attics. Architects today still marvel at the design, which allowed the Colosseum to be emptied inside 12 minutes (think of their next time you are near a major sporting event)!
